What to Eat

Morogoro has a variety of restaurants that serve both local and international cuisine.

  • Ugali: Ugali is a staple food in Tanzania. It is made from cornmeal and is usually served with a variety of sauces.
  • Nyama choma: Nyama choma is grilled meat. It is usually served with ugali or rice.
  • Pilau: Pilau is a rice dish that is cooked with spices and meat.

Where to Go

Morogoro is a great place to visit for both nature lovers and history buffs.

  • Uluguru Mountains: The Uluguru Mountains are a beautiful mountain range that is home to a variety of flora and fauna.
  • Morogoro Museum: The Morogoro Museum is a great place to learn about the history of Morogoro.
  • Mikumi National Park: Mikumi National Park is a national park that is home to a variety of animals, including elephants, lions, zebras, and giraffes.
